WebOne third of adults in Wales (an estimated 800,000) report having at least one long term condition. Two thirds of people aged over 65 in Wales report having at least one long term condition, and one third have multiple long term conditions. More than three-quarters of people aged 85-plus in Wales reported having a limiting long-term illness. WebNHS plans. WebThe treatment of long-term conditions incurs immense costs for the health and social care system as a whole. The Department of Health estimated that people with LTCs are the biggest users of healthcare services, with treatment and care for long-term conditions absorbing 70% of acute and primary care spending in England (DHSC 2015). For Web4 de nov. de 2015 · A long‑term condition is one that generally lasts a year or longer and impacts on a person's life. Examples include arthritis, asthma, cancer, dementia, diabetes, heart disease, mental health conditions and stroke. Long‑term conditions may also be known as 'chronic conditions'.
